Place the chopped scallion and ginger root in a small bowl. Add a cup of water to the bowl.
To a large mixing bowl, add the ground pork, white pepper powder, salt, and a whole egg.
Add the scallion/ginger infused water to the large mixing bowl. Squeeze the scallion/ginger to release extra juice to the mixing bowl.
Use one hand to mix everything in the mixing bowl continuously in one direction (clockwise or counter clockwise) for 5 mins until the mixture is uniform and sticky.
Scoop the mixture with both hands. Raise your hands about 12" above the mixing bowl. Drop the mixture with force into the bowl about 50-75 times. The mixture will be so sticky that it won't fall out when the mixing bowl turned upside down.
Heat the stock(water) in the stainless steel pot to boil.
Mix the starch with 3 tbsp of water in a small bowl.
Scoop some pork mixture with one hand. Wet the other hand with the starch soup. Toss the meatball between your hands to make it round. The meatball should be about the size of a toddler's fist.
Place the meatball into the boiling stock/water. Continue the process until the entire pork mixture is consumed.
Rinse nappa cabbage leaves, and put them on top of the meatballs.
Put the lid on. Bring the soup to boiling. Turn the heat to low and simmer for 2 hours.
